LOS ANGELES—On October 21, Grammy Award-winning band SYSTEM OF A DOWN will receive the 2015 Parajanov-Vartanov Institute Award for the virtuous commitment to justice exemplified by their historic Wake Up The Souls tour. The event will take place on October 21 at the Chateau Marmont in Hollywood.
The institute studies, preserves and promotes the work of the brothers-in-arts Sergei Parajanov and Mikhail Vartanov, who, like System Of A Down, dedicated their lives to the righteous fight against the injustices of totalitarian regimes. Parajanov (1924-1990) and Vartanov (1937-2009) were admired by some of the most important figures in cinema, literature and art.
Proceeds from the October 21st event will benefit the restoration of Vartanov’s Parajanov: The Last Spring film trilogy at UCLA.
